Comparison review

Xperia PRO-I is way better than Moto G60, getting a 96.3 score against 79.5. These phones come with the same Android 11 operating system. The Xperia PRO-I body is somewhat thinner and just a little lighter than the Moto G60, although both were only released with a couple months difference. Xperia PRO-I has a little bit better hardware performance than Moto G60, and although they both have a Octa-Core CPU, the Xperia PRO-I also has a larger amount of RAM.

The Sony Xperia PRO-I has a more vivid display than Moto G60, because although it has a little smaller display, it also counts with a lot higher 1644 x 3840 pixels resolution and a lot better number of pixels per inch of screen. The Moto G60 captures much clearer pictures and videos than Sony Xperia PRO-I, because although it has lower 30 frames per second video frame rates, and they both have the same 3840x2160 (4K) video definition, the Moto G60 also counts with a bigger aperture for better low-light photography and a much better 108 MP resolution back facing camera.

The Xperia PRO-I counts with a way bigger memory capacity for games and applications than Motorola Moto G60, and although they both have an external SD slot that supports up to 1 TB, the Xperia PRO-I also has 512 GB internal memory. Moto G60 counts with greater battery duration than Sony Xperia PRO-I, because it has a 33% more battery capacity.
